Description: Uses a letter and a term paper to illustrate the power potential in precise nouns and verbs. Teaches students to recognize the difference between general and specific and demonstrates how the use of specific detail improves writing., How communicating specific information and carefully selecting specific nouns, verbs, adjectives, and adverbs can add interest and clarity to a theme, short story, technical report, letter, or any kind of writing.

Complete Record: , Uses several situations such as a theme paper, description of a dog, and a letter home to illustrate how the careful use of parts of speech improves communication imagery, interest, and understanding.
